Output 43db960de098a9da368f173a46d0f907f58c164bf93c5f386a643fdc5099ea84:1

value
23346
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6f109954e63255939c162e1ca4a3d92d3903b1c8ecdaa8fb4f2120ef1e3a2a96
address
bc1pdugfj48xxf2e88qk9cw2fg7e95us8vwgand23760yysw783692tqddsgg3
transaction
43db960de098a9da368f173a46d0f907f58c164bf93c5f386a643fdc5099ea84
spent
true